Star Trek - the Next Generation: Dark Mirror by Diane Duane
This adventure reveals the crew members of the "Starship Enterprise" in mortal combat against the most savage enemy they have ever encountered - themselves. Set in the 24th century, a mirror image of the world is populated by nightmare duplicates of the celebrated crew.
Diane Duane is the author of a score of novels of science fiction and fantasy, among them the New York Times hardcover bestsellers, Spock's World and Dark Mirror, as well as the very popular Wizard Fantasy series, and a second Spider-Man hardcover novel entitled The Lizard Sanction. She is hard at work on a third Spidey novel, The Octopus Agenda. Duane lives with her husband, Peter Morwood--with whom she has written five novels, including the New York Times bestseller, The Romulan Way--in a beautiful valley in rural Ireland.
